Hyundai Genesis (DH): Lighting System / License Lamps Repair procedures

Removal
1.
Disconnect the negative (-) battery terminal.
2.
Remove the trunk lid panel.
(Refer to Body - "Trunk Lid Back Panel")
3.
Remove the license lamp after disengaging the license lamp mounting clip (A)

4.
Remove the license lamp assembly after disconnecting the license connector (A).

Installation
1.
Install the license lamp assembly.
2.
Install the trunk lid.
